Gatecount is the turnstile counter service for Harrowfield Stadium. Releases cut from `main` after the count-reconciliation tests pass; the reviewer should confirm that per-gate tallies match the aggregate within the configured drift tolerance. Version bumps follow semver, with the schema version pinned in `counts/proto`. Note that the edge devices at the stadium reject unsigned firmware bundles outright, so every release artifact must be signed before upload. The bundle signer expects the deploy key given directly below this section.

rollout seal: bky4_yke3

**Ticket #— Quiet Room, Floor 9**

Request from the Pellard team: the quiet room on the top floor (9.14) has had its lock rekeyed after the refurb, and the old badge permissions no longer work. Room is booked solid next week for focus sessions. Please re-enrol the floor 9 badge group and confirm the motion-sensor light is fixed. Until permissions sync, staff can enter with the keypad code below.

turnstile pass: bdg-R-53

# FareForge Env Vars

Hey future maintainer: FareForge evaluates shipping-fee rules per region, and most config lives in rules.yaml. The env file only carries runtime bits — port, log level, rule cache TTL. The exception is the carrier rate API, which needs a secret to fetch live tariffs. Open .env.fareforge and add the following line at the bottom:

secret setting of yaweg-hahig: COURIER_KEY5=39d45